It remains stable the unemployment rate in OECD countries rose to 7,9% in September, as the Organization for Economic Co-operation and Development itself states, while in the Eurozone the figure increased for the sixteenth consecutive month, reaching 11,6% from 11,5% in August.
Unemployment is also on the rise in Italy, where it has risen to 10,8%, from 10,6%. In the entire OECD area, the number of unemployed stood at 47,6 million units, 400 thousand less than in August, but a good 12,9 million more than four years ago. The unemployed young people, according to the Organization, are 11,6 million.
